copyright Heat Pump Prices in The Country : A Comprehensive Breakdown

Understanding the cost relating to copyright heat units in New Zealand can be complex. Typically, installation costs vary widely depending on various factors. A basic model for a compact home might range from roughly $5,000 to $8,000, including basic installation. However , more premium models, or those involving significant electrical upgrades or ducting adjustments, may easily push the final price up to $12,000 or even greater. Note that such figures are estimates; obtaining multiple quotes from reputable professionals is strongly recommended to find the most competitive price for a specific needs .
